Cortaire

A densely packed city-state that has drawn in more citizens than it can sustain. Slums line the outer walls of the city, keeping the majority of the populace relatively safe from invaders.

Demographics

Primarily human, immense wealth inequality

Government

Cortaire is governed by its military force after the established democracy failed to contain the rise of refugees and immigrants. Cortaire focuses on expansion in order to keep its inhabitants occupied and working, as the city-state has lost the ability to be self-sustaining after the sharp population increase decades ago.

Defences

Cortaire is a rare City-state that has built fortified outposts outside of its city limits, creating forward operating bases to further secure their borders. Soldiers, sparsely equipped, patrol the reaches of the state to scare off potential invaders. Cortaire employs strength in overwhelming numbers when it comes to military operations.

History

Once a bustling trade hub for city-states around the world to visit, Cortaire's population spiked suddenly as refugees and immigrants ventured into the city after troubles emerged in the world. Unable to scale up infrastructure quick enough, Cortaire suffered from too many mouths to feed, resulting in the collapse of the government and the subsequent takeover by its military. Cortaire now seeks to expand as a means to survive, delving into the aether-starved Wilds that surround their borders.

Geography

Built around a river on largely flat plains, Cortaire sits within a temperate climate with no harsh weather conditions to add to their myriad of issues.
